[英]Cut and paste in a for loop in VBA
我正在尝试将for循环中的值从一个列表剪切并粘贴到另一个列表。 我已经设置了所有范围,但是由于某种原因, paste
一直失败,并且我不确定为什么。 到目前为止,这是我尝试过的方法:
If WrdArray1(0) = WrdArray2(0) Then
ActiveCell.Cut
With ActiveSheet
Set rng2 = .Range("C" & position)
rng2.PasteSpecial
End With
我对vba还是比较陌生,因此将不胜感激。
只需使用ActiveCell.Cut Destination:=ActiveSheet.Range("C" & position)
。 这一切合而为一。
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.